A member of the New York anti-folk scene that developed in the early part of the 21st century, singer/songwriter Jaymay (real name: Jamie Kristine Seerman) has drawn comparisons to <a href="spotify:artist:6CWTBjOJK75cTE8Xv8u1kj">Feist</a> and <a href="spotify:artist:0jkK3K1ATFFHofEWjd2i00">Laura Veirs</a> with her wistful vocals and literate, folksy narratives. Jaymay spent her childhood in Long Island, where she was raised alongside five siblings and developed an early love for books, violin, piano, and the <a href="spotify:artist:74ASZWbe4lXaubB36ztrGX">Bob Dylan</a> songbook. Following college, she relocated to Manhattan with the intention of pursuing a publishing career, but a successful performance at a local open mic night convinced her to focus on songwriting instead. More performances followed, and Jaymay released Jaymay & Kayoko and the Sea Green, See Blue EP in 2006. The popularity of these releases earned her a contract with the London-based Heavenly Records, who issued Jaymay's official debut, Autumn Fallin', in November 2007. An American release followed in early 2008. ~ Andrew Leahey & Chris True, Rovi
